- Amiga AGA The lost pixellers vol.1 by Ghostown
- Thanks for the vid. It was worth the wait!
What can I say except AWESOME!! The scene has been lacking classic slideshows such as this and these days you rarely even get painted pictures in demos, so it was a real flash back to the good old days.
The music and presentation were perfect. The images themselves ranged from stunning to subtly stylish. I'm loving some of the dithering techniques used by these guys. It gives the work texture and character, which is more than can be said for the faux-painted Photoshop pictures that are trending today. It really makes me miss my pixelling days.
Anyway, enough praise. I look forward to seeing volume 2! - rulezadded on the 2011-09-09 09:33:44
